If I use the 0ppm sterile water and add cal mag + potassium silicate would that give me a good water source?
For our purposes sterile water and RO water are virtually the same thing. So yes you can use it. If you have some hookup where it is free by all means go for it. If you are paying for it you will regret not just buying an RO system
